KFC’s Supply Chain Overview

KFC operates on a global scale, and its chicken supply chain is complex and multi-faceted. Here are key points about how KFC sources its chicken:

  • Global Suppliers: KFC partners with various suppliers in different countries, ensuring a steady supply of high-quality chicken.
  • Quality Standards: The brand has strict quality control measures in place to ensure that all chicken meets its standards for freshness and safety.
  • Local Sourcing: In many regions, KFC sources its chicken locally to support regional agriculture and reduce transportation costs.

Steps in KFC’s Chicken Sourcing Process

Understanding the steps KFC takes in sourcing its chicken can provide clarity on their operations:

  1. Supplier Selection: KFC evaluates potential suppliers based on their ability to meet quality, safety, and ethical standards.
  2. Farm Partnerships: The company often partners with farms that adhere to humane animal treatment practices, ensuring that the chickens are raised in a responsible manner.
  3. Inspection and Compliance: Regular inspections are conducted to ensure that suppliers comply with KFC’s guidelines and local regulations.
  4. Distribution: Once the chicken passes quality checks, it is transported to KFC restaurants through an established distribution network.
  5. Preparation: In restaurants, the chicken is prepared according to KFC’s secret recipes, ensuring that customers receive a consistent product.

Challenges in Chicken Sourcing

While KFC has a robust sourcing strategy, there are challenges:

  • Supply Chain Disruptions: Global events, such as pandemics or natural disasters, can disrupt the supply chain, affecting availability.
  • Regulatory Compliance: Navigating different regulations in various countries can be complex and time-consuming.
  • Consumer Expectations: As customers become more conscious of sourcing practices, KFC must continuously adapt to meet these evolving demands.
